Tradescant Drive is in Meopham, Gravesend and in Gravesham district. DA13 0EE is located in the Meopham North elect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Gravesham.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Safety

Is Tradescant Drive Street dangerous?

In 2023, 55 crimes were reported near Tradescant Drive . 69% of streets in the UK are more dangerous. This street can be considered safe. The most common type of crime was violence and sexual offences. Crime rate was measured within a 0.5 mile radius of DA13 0EE.

Employment

The percentage of retired residents living in DA13 0EE area is much higher than the country's average. According to Census 2011, 40% residents of this area were retired, while the average in the UK was 14%.
